    FRISCO SQUARE - 60 ACRES Frisco Square is similar to a European village; a pedestrian-friendly urban environment in Frisco, Texas. Designed by David M. Schwartz; whose work includes the American Airlines Center in Dallas, the Ballpark in Arlington, and the Bass Performance Hall in Fort Worth; along with O’Brein, Boka & Powell whose notable work includes The Star in Frisco. The development encompasses office, retail, multi-family and municipal product located on over 60 acres in one of fastest growing cities in the United States. Located right off the Dallas North Tollway and across the street south of Toyota Stadium; home of FC Dallas soccer club. Frisco Square is comprised of over 300,000 sf office, 200,000 sf retail/restaurant, 1000 multi-family units, Frisco City Hall, Cinemark theater, Forest Park Hospital, and Grace Church.

    ADDISON CIRCLE - 40 ACRES Principals of Wolverine were the master-planner, developer and operating partner of Addison Circle located in Addison, TX along the Dallas North Tollway. They were the visionary and developer of over 1,300 multi-family units with 300,000 sf of class A office and 50,000 sf first floor retail/restaurant space. The project was completed in phases in 1993 – 2001 and sold a couple years later after it was fully leased. They negotiated a favorable incentive package with the city of Addison which jumpstarted the project and created additional value for their stake holders.

    UPTOWN DALLAS - 2,000 APARTMENTS

    The principals of Wolverine Interests developed many of the first multi-family complexes in the Dallas Uptown submarket through the 1980’s – 90’s. Their gamble to be the first movers in uptown paid off huge as tons of restaurants, retail, office and other multi-family quickly followed their lead to build out uptown to what it has become today. They were the local originator of the multi-family “wrap” product which wraps the complex around the parking garage, thereby maximizing efficiency of the building. All of their multi-family complexes in uptown were sold soon after they leased up.

    DOWNTOWN PLANO - 750 APARTMENTS Jim Leslie and partners helped kick started downtown Plano with the development of three multi-family complexes comprising close to 750 units. His team worked with City officials to provide the urban lifestyle and boost needed to further activate the old historic downtown area. The project included the land acquisition, overall design and development, all financing and ultimately the sale of the properties once fully occupied.

    SHOPS AT LEGACY - 1,500 APARTMENTS Principals of Wolverine Interests developed the initial multi-family complexes in what is now known as the Shops at Legacy, Plano, TX. They were the early visionary of what the Shops could become and realized the first component necessary was to get people living there before the shops and restaurants could be successful. Their multi-family development was the spark needed for Shops at Legacy to evolve into the beautiful live, work, play atmosphere it has become today. They made the site selection, financed, developed, leased up and later sold the first Legacy multi-family complexes in 1995 – 2003.

  • JIM LESLIE - Managing Principal

    Jim Leslie serves as a Managing Principal for Wolverine Interests.

    With nearly 40 years of experience in the real estate and financial markets, Mr. Leslie is recognized for successfully pairing creative real

    estate development with his intense understanding of capital markets. After completing his MBA at University of Michigan in 1979, Jim

    moved to Dallas and began his career at Coopers and Lybrand where he became a CPA and led an audit team. In 1982, Jim joined Roger

    Staubach as a founding member of The Staubach Company and served as their CFO where he designed, recapitalized, and launched the

    strategic plan of pioneering the tenant representation industry. Jim quickly became President of TSC and grew the company from 5 people

    in one Dallas office to over 1,200 employees across 50 offices worldwide.

    In 1991, Jim formed the Financial Services Division of TSC and initiated over $3 billion of financing for clients around the world. These

    financing activities led to an expansion of the division’s capabilities to include acting as a principal in over $8 billion of sale-leaseback

    purchases that were primarily sold into the 1031 exchange market. During his time at TSC, Jim also developed over 8,000 multi-family units

    and developed or purchased and sold tens of millions of square feet of commercial space.

    In 2001, Jim formed Wolverine Interests where he acts as managing principal in financing, development, and asset management of

    numerous multi-family, office, and large mixed-use projects with private/public partnerships. Some of Jim’s recent notable projects include

    Frisco Square – a 60 acre mixed-use development in Frisco, TX; Addison Circle – a 40 acre mixed-use development in Addison, TX; 1,200

    multi-family units in Shops at Legacy in Plano, TX; and 2,000 multi-family units in the Uptown Dallas area.

    Within the last few years, Wolverine has acquired over 3 million square feet of office product along the Dallas North Tollway, George Bush

    Turnpike, and Las Colinas market. Mr. Leslie has served on or is currently serving as a board member for several public and private

    companies including Stratus Properties, Wyndham Hotels, Amresco Capital Trust, Sebring Capital, Cresa Partners, Columbus Realty Trust,

    Salvo, Team Mouse, Dougherty’s Holdings and others. Jim was the leader in taking some of these companies public such as Stratus and

    Wyndham, as well as forming REITS such as Columbus Realty.

    Jim grew up in Lincoln, NE where he received his BS in Mathematics and Actuarial Science from the University of Nebraska then achieved his

    MBA from the University of Michigan.

  • JOE JERNIGAN - Principal

    Joe Jernigan began his career in commercial real estate in 1980. He has been a Partner at Wolverine Interests since 2014.

    At Wolverine Mr. Jernigan is actively involved in the firm’s development, acquisitions, financings and investment sales efforts. Mr. Jernigan’s

    real estate career began with 3-years of commercial brokerage where he exclusively represented a number of high net worth investors in the

    acquisition, management and disposition of multi-family properties in the Dallas-Ft. Worth markets. Mr. Jernigan then joined a Dallas based

    real estate firm where he represented a number of the firm’s institutional clients in the acquisition, management and disposition of North

    Texas anchored retail properties.

    The late 1980’s saw a significant downturn in commercial real estate values in part resulting in the insolvency of numerous federally insured

    Texas based Savings & Loans. As Executive Vice President of BEI Mr. Jernigan, working through various contracts with the Federal Savings

    and Loan Insurance Corporation (FSLIC), directed the management and liquidation of approximately $8.0 billion of commercial real estate

    assets and mortgages contained within 5 Texas based federally insured institutions that had been determined insolvent by the FSLIC. In

    1990 the Resolution Trust Corporation (RTC) was created to expedite the nationwide liquidation of commercial real estate assets and

    mortgages of insolvent federally insured banks and thrifts. For 3-years Mr. Jernigan, as Executive Vice President of BEI, served as the senior

    manager for one of the RTC’s largest contractors directing five nation-wide BEI offices in the liquidation of over $3.5 billion of RTC assets

    through nine separate RTC contracts.

    In 1996 Mr. Jernigan joined GE Capital Real Estate as Senior Vice President. His responsibilities at GE included senior management of a $3.0

    billion CMBS Special Serving portfolio and senior manager of 4 “off book” joint venture real estate transactions comprised of approximately

    $6.0 billion of non -performing GE commercial real estate assets and mortgages. In 2000 Mr. Jernigan joined Presidio Investments, a real

    estate company established by a wealthy Dallas oil family focused on acquiring office buildings in the southwestern United States. During a

    3-year period Mr. Jernigan acquired 6 office buildings valued in excess of $150 million.

    In 2003 Mr. Jernigan joined the Lone Star Fund/Hudson Advisors, a $37 billion private equity fund, as Executive Vice President of North

    American Asset Management. At Lone Star Mr. Jernigan’s directed a team responsible for the liquidation of a portfolio of real estate assets

    and mortgages valued in excess of $1.5 billion. In 2006 Mr. Jernigan joined Behringer Harvard REIT as Senior Vice President primarily

    responsible for acquisition of “value-add” assets for the $500 million BH Opportunity REIT I and the $750 million BH Opportunity REIT II.
